Tender Overview

Organization: Nuclear Power Corporation Of India Limited (Department Of Atomic Energy) in Tirunelveli, Tamil Nadu. Procurement for Annual Maintenance Services for Water Purification and Conditioning System ( potable water purifier with inbuilt water cooler ) across 70 units. Contract duration: 24 months with bid pricing per unit. Estimated value not disclosed; EMD is ₹26,888. Key differentiator includes MSE purchase preference under the public policy and GST-compliant invoicing requirements. This contract targets reliable servicing of water purification systems across the site, emphasizing compliance with invoicing in consignee name and GST portal confirmations. Unique scope: bulk 70-unit maintenance with quarterly/periodic servicing expectations and supplier flexibility in contract duration within 25% per the purchase clause.

What is the MSME purchase preference criteria for this tender?

MSME bidders must be the manufacturer or service provider of the offered product/service and provide documentary evidence. If L-1 is not an MSE, eligible MSE bidders may match within ** +15% margin** to win a contract for the eligible portion.
